## Deploying the Gatewick Proctor Queue

Deploys are pretty painless: push to main, wait for the pipeline, then watch the queue drain dashboard for five minutes. If candidates pile up mid-exam, roll back first and ask questions later — the queue replays safely. Everything the workers care about lives in one config block, shown here for reference.

settings of bafof-yagef:
JOROX_PIN=8740
JOROX_TENANT=pelox
JOROX_METRICS_HOST=metrics.jorox.qorvelworks.internal
JOROX_SEAL=seal_c78f63c1
JOROX_STANDBY_TEAM=norax

Minutes — Management Meeting, Heads of Department. Attendees reviewed the term sheet from Ostrell Partners. Key points: staged investment of 5m, board observer seat, and a right of first refusal on the Kellward unit. Legal to redline the ROFR clause. Finance to model dilution scenarios by Thursday. The agreed response strategy is recorded below.

confidential, kagep-kahof: Druokax Systems plans to lower the Ulaath list price by 53 percent in March.

## Tuning the rate cache

If Ledgerleaf support tickets mention stale tax rates, it's almost always the cache, not the lookup service. The cache refreshes jurisdictions lazily, so a rate change won't show up until the entry expires or someone forces a flush from the admin panel. Before escalating, compare the ticket's timestamp against the TTL. The current cache settings are these.

tuning table, kajog-bawip:
TIERS = {
    "kelius": 256,
    "lammir": 543,
}

## Formula sandbox tuning

User-supplied formulas in Gridmoor execute inside a restricted interpreter with hard ceilings on time, memory, and call depth. Reviewers should confirm any change to these ceilings is justified in the PR description, since raising them widens the abuse surface. Defaults were chosen from production traces. The current limits are as follows.

limits module of tafog-fawip:
WEIGHTS = {
    "julix": 57,
    "lamys": 992,
    "kasvan": 209,
    "quenok": 750,
    "alddor": 259,
    "oliath": 1009,
    "wenix": 815,
}